Mize, Hynek Homer in Win over Brown

Game 2 of Doubleheader Suspended Due to Light Malfunction

ATLANTA -- Will Mize and Colin Hynek homered and Jesse Donohoe drove in four runs to lead Georgia State to a 10-4 victory over Brown in the first game of a doubleheader at the GSU Baseball Complex. 

Game 2 was suspended due to a light malfunction after four innings with GSU leading 4-0 and will be resumed Sunday at 11 a.m. The series finale will follow.

In Game 1, Georgia State led 5-4 after six innings before breaking the game open with five runs in the seventh. Donohoe delivered a two-out, two-run single, and then Hynek, a redshirt freshman, belted a 3-run homer for a 10-4 lead. Not only was that Hynek's first career homer, but it was his first hit.

The Panthers (3-3) jumped in front with two runs in the first on an RBI-groundout by JoJo Jackson and a run-scoring single by Donohoe. Donohoe, the sophomore second baseman from Columbus, Ga., also drove in run with a groundout in the fifth inning to give him four RBI for the game and eight over the last two games after hitting a grand slam Friday.

Mize hit a two-run homer, his first, to give the Panthers a 4-0 lead after two innings.

Freshman reliever Davis Chastain (1-1) picked up his first win, and Zach Ottinger finished the game with two scoreless innings.

In the nightcap, sophomore outfielder JoJo Jackson hit his team-leading fourth homer of the season with an opposite field solo shot in the third. GSU starter Joseph Brandon retired the first 11 batters before allowing a walk and then a single. He struck out six in four innings.
